Home of the Day: Tudor style on the Westside

Jan. 19--Set on close to half an acre in Brentwood, this Tudor-style house invites entertaining with a den with a wet bar, a wood-paneled library and formal living and dining rooms topped with box-beam ceilings. French doors open to reveal a wide terrace balcony overlooking a covered patio and a fenced swimming pool and spa.

Location: 1756 Correa Way, Los Angeles, 90049

Lease price: $19,000 a month

Year built: 1975

House size: 6,102 square feet, six bedrooms, 5.5 bathrooms

Lot size: 0.47 acres

Features: Hardwood floors; vaulted ceilings with exposed box beams; step-down formal living room with fireplace; formal dining room; den with wet bar; wood-paneled library/office; center-island kitchen; master suite with fireplace; formal landscaping; patio; swimming pool and spa

About the area: In November, 26 single-family homes sold in the 90049 ZIP Code at a median price of $2.82 million, according to Corelogic. That was a 25.3% increase in price compared to the previous year.
